Kostunica was elected President of the Federal Republic of Yugoslavia after defeating Slobodan Milosevic in the presidential election. His victory marked the end of Milosevic's rule and the beginning of democratic transition.
Kostunica oversaw the readmission of the Federal Republic of Yugoslavia to the United Nations. The country had been suspended from the UN during the Milosevic era due to the wars in the former Yugoslavia.
Kostunica, as Prime Minister of Serbia, strongly opposed the unilateral declaration of independence by Kosovo. He pursued diplomatic and legal measures to prevent international recognition of Kosovo's independence.
